Meilleur config matériel pour serveur ?
39 messages
• Page 1 sur 3 • 1, 2, 3
Consultez la formation à Google Analytics de WebRankInfo / Ranking Metrics
- thierry8
- WRInaute accro

- Messages: 3251
- Inscription: 11 Juil 2005
Meilleur config matériel pour serveur ?
Bonjour,
celon vous quel est la meilleur config:
1)
Intel Celeron à 3.00 Ghz avec 2048 Mo
2 * 80 Go SATA RAID 1 logiciel
2)
Intel Pentium à 3.00 Ghz avec 512 Mo
2 * 80 Go SATA RAID 1 logiciel
Tous les commentaires sont les bien venues !
Merci.
celon vous quel est la meilleur config:
1)
Intel Celeron à 3.00 Ghz avec 2048 Mo
2 * 80 Go SATA RAID 1 logiciel
2)
Intel Pentium à 3.00 Ghz avec 512 Mo
2 * 80 Go SATA RAID 1 logiciel
Tous les commentaires sont les bien venues !
Merci.
-

biddybulle - WRInaute passionné

- Messages: 1619
- Inscription: 30 Mai 2005
la mémoire c'est quand meme fort utile enfin bon
tu vas pas faire de l'utlisation de librairies GD à tout bout champs ?
tu vas pas faire de l'utlisation de librairies GD à tout bout champs ?
- thierry8
- WRInaute accro

- Messages: 3251
- Inscription: 11 Juil 2005
Base de données: oui plusieurs
cron: oui plusieurs
Nombre de sites: indéterminé (plusieurs
)
Dynamique: oui, tous
Mais là n'est pas la question car tu ne sera pas plus avancé,
je ne demande pas par rapport à quoi, mais votre avis pour un serveur
normal, en temps normal, tout ce qui est standard quoi.....!
Après si tu veux faire en statistiques faudrait savoir vraiment tout,
genre, combien de bases, combien de cron, combien de sites, combien de
pages par site, combien de visiteurs par site, la complexité des scripts, etc...
cron: oui plusieurs
Nombre de sites: indéterminé (plusieurs
Dynamique: oui, tous
Mais là n'est pas la question car tu ne sera pas plus avancé,
je ne demande pas par rapport à quoi, mais votre avis pour un serveur
normal, en temps normal, tout ce qui est standard quoi.....!
Après si tu veux faire en statistiques faudrait savoir vraiment tout,
genre, combien de bases, combien de cron, combien de sites, combien de
pages par site, combien de visiteurs par site, la complexité des scripts, etc...
- thierry8
- WRInaute accro

- Messages: 3251
- Inscription: 11 Juil 2005
Interessant en effet !
Mais mysql gère comment la mémoire ?
Je suppose que par défaut on lui attribue une taille, ou lors de l'instal cela ce fait automatiquement ? (si non quel est cette variable ?)
ou alors cela est simplement géré par mysql...sans indication 'humaine'
Mais mysql gère comment la mémoire ?
Je suppose que par défaut on lui attribue une taille, ou lors de l'instal cela ce fait automatiquement ? (si non quel est cette variable ?)
ou alors cela est simplement géré par mysql...sans indication 'humaine'
-

chava2b - WRInaute occasionnel

- Messages: 263
- Inscription: 5 Déc 2003
Mysql va fonctionner avec la memoire que tu as;
Maintenant, pour optimiser le temps d'execution des requetes, tu as l'interet de mettre un max de table en memoire (cache) pour eviter les acces au disque. Donc tu peux modifier la config de mysql en fonction de ta memoire et plus t'as de memoire plus ta config est optimale.
L'optimisation n'est pas automatique, c'est a toi de dire : "chaque process va consommé xxMo, j'ai Y connexion" pour determiner ta config (On parle d'otimisation, tu px tjrs laisser les parametres par defaut ou t'as pas a te poser de question)
Maintenant, pour optimiser le temps d'execution des requetes, tu as l'interet de mettre un max de table en memoire (cache) pour eviter les acces au disque. Donc tu peux modifier la config de mysql en fonction de ta memoire et plus t'as de memoire plus ta config est optimale.
L'optimisation n'est pas automatique, c'est a toi de dire : "chaque process va consommé xxMo, j'ai Y connexion" pour determiner ta config (On parle d'otimisation, tu px tjrs laisser les parametres par defaut ou t'as pas a te poser de question)
- thierry8
- WRInaute accro

- Messages: 3251
- Inscription: 11 Juil 2005
d'accord, mais si on laisse par défaut, la valeur sera la même que ce soit sur un serveur avec 512 de RAM ou 2024 de RAM ? donc pas de différence...
"tu as l'interet de mettre un max de table en memoire (cache) pour eviter les acces au disque"
C'est à dire ? Comment les mettres en cache, c'est po automatique ?
désolé de mon ignorance... 
"tu as l'interet de mettre un max de table en memoire (cache) pour eviter les acces au disque"
C'est à dire ? Comment les mettres en cache, c'est po automatique ?
-

sonikbuzz - WRInaute occasionnel

- Messages: 469
- Inscription: 21 Fév 2005
512Mo c'est largement suffisant pour un serveur web classique (en tous cas sous linux)
Ceux qui utilise plus 512Mo je serais curieux de voir le résultat de la commande : ps -aux
Ou alors oui d'accord l'intégralité des bases mysql en cache mémoire
Donc dans ton cas je choisirais le cpu sans hésiter
Ceux qui utilise plus 512Mo je serais curieux de voir le résultat de la commande : ps -aux
Ou alors oui d'accord l'intégralité des bases mysql en cache mémoire
Donc dans ton cas je choisirais le cpu sans hésiter
- thierry8
- WRInaute accro

- Messages: 3251
- Inscription: 11 Juil 2005
chava2b peut tu me répondre par rapport à dessus !
chava2b a écrit:Mysql va fonctionner avec la memoire que tu as;
Maintenant, pour optimiser le temps d'execution des requetes, tu as l'interet de mettre un max de table en memoire (cache) pour eviter les acces au disque. Donc tu peux modifier la config de mysql en fonction de ta memoire et plus t'as de memoire plus ta config est optimale.
L'optimisation n'est pas automatique, c'est a toi de dire : "chaque process va consommé xxMo, j'ai Y connexion" pour determiner ta config (On parle d'otimisation, tu px tjrs laisser les parametres par defaut ou t'as pas a te poser de question)
thierry8 a écrit:d'accord, mais si on laisse par défaut, la valeur sera la même que ce soit sur un serveur avec 512 de RAM ou 2024 de RAM ? donc pas de différence...
"tu as l'interet de mettre un max de table en memoire (cache) pour eviter les acces au disque"
C'est à dire ? Comment les mettres en cache, c'est po automatique ?
![]()
désolé de mon ignorance...
-

sonikbuzz - WRInaute occasionnel

- Messages: 469
- Inscription: 21 Fév 2005
http://www.toutjavascript.com/savoir/op ... mysql.php3
et
http://maximilian.developpez.com/mysql/queryCache/
et la doc mysql
PS1 : rien ne vos une bonne structure et des requetes optimisées
PS2 : je reste persuadé que dans la trés grande majorité des cas le serveur P IV sera bien plus rapide.
et
http://maximilian.developpez.com/mysql/queryCache/
et la doc mysql
PS1 : rien ne vos une bonne structure et des requetes optimisées
PS2 : je reste persuadé que dans la trés grande majorité des cas le serveur P IV sera bien plus rapide.
-

chava2b - WRInaute occasionnel

- Messages: 263
- Inscription: 5 Déc 2003
oups... c'est vrai j'ai pas repondu
Mysql va allouer une taille memoire definie dans ta config.
De plus, mysql est en multithread c'est a dire que plusieur mysql peuvent se lancer en meme temps
Cette taille memoire va dependre des parametres; Ces parametres dependent du styles de tes requetes. (beaucoup de tri, tables liées, index...)
Evidement, on part du principe que tes requetes sont bien faites.
Si la config est la meme, y a pas trop de difference; maintenant, avec 2Go de ram tu px modifier ta config pour que ca soit plus optimal
Donc à mon avis, le maillon faible est l'acces au disque; D'ou l'interet à mettre le maximum en memoire;
Pour l'exemple du cache (y a d'autre parametre comme les buffers ou le nbre de table a ouvrir) par defaut c'est a 16Mo;
S'il se rempli vite ben il va faire de nouveau acces au disque; D'ou l'interet de l'augmenter
Dans phpmyadmin, dans 'etat du serveur' plein de parametre vont te permettre cette optimisation;
Pour finir, c'est sur c'est peut etre different, mais par exemple tu px faire tourner windows XP sur un P2 233Mhz avec 512Mo de memoire mais tu ne peux pas le faire tourner sur un P4 3Ghz avec 64Mo....
Mysql va allouer une taille memoire definie dans ta config.
De plus, mysql est en multithread c'est a dire que plusieur mysql peuvent se lancer en meme temps
Cette taille memoire va dependre des parametres; Ces parametres dependent du styles de tes requetes. (beaucoup de tri, tables liées, index...)
Evidement, on part du principe que tes requetes sont bien faites.
Si la config est la meme, y a pas trop de difference; maintenant, avec 2Go de ram tu px modifier ta config pour que ca soit plus optimal
Donc à mon avis, le maillon faible est l'acces au disque; D'ou l'interet à mettre le maximum en memoire;
Pour l'exemple du cache (y a d'autre parametre comme les buffers ou le nbre de table a ouvrir) par defaut c'est a 16Mo;
S'il se rempli vite ben il va faire de nouveau acces au disque; D'ou l'interet de l'augmenter
Dans phpmyadmin, dans 'etat du serveur' plein de parametre vont te permettre cette optimisation;
Pour finir, c'est sur c'est peut etre different, mais par exemple tu px faire tourner windows XP sur un P2 233Mhz avec 512Mo de memoire mais tu ne peux pas le faire tourner sur un P4 3Ghz avec 64Mo....
39 messages
• Page 1 sur 3 • 1, 2, 3
Formation recommandée sur ce thème :
Formation Google Analytics : en 2 jours, apprenez comment exploiter l'essentiel des possibilités de l'outil de mesure d'audience de Google. Formation animée par les experts Google Analytics de Ranking Metrics.
Tous les détails sur le site Ranking Metrics : programme, prix, dates et lieux, inscription en ligne.
Lectures recommandées sur ce thème :
- Pb config de serveur
- Config PHP d'un serveur
- Serveur Dédié : config des emails
- votre avis sur config serveur virtuel
- Serveur dans le pays ciblé pour un meilleur référencement: c'est vrai?
- Vaut-il mieux choisir un serveur dédié en France pour un meilleur référencement dans les m
- Meilleure format, meilleur intégration, meilleur couleurs
- Loi revente matériel
- Dépense en matériel informatique
- demande conseil choix materiel
Consultez la description détaillée des produits ou services de Google suivants : Google Web Accelerator
- Analyse de la classe C (adresse IP)
Cet outil vous permet de vérifier si plusieurs sites sont hébergés sur la même classe C (adresse IP du serveur). - Analyse de l'entête HTTP
Cet outil vous permet de connaître le code HTTP renvoyé par le serveur pour une page donnée.
Qui est en ligne
Utilisateurs parcourant ce forum: Aucun utilisateur enregistré et 1 invité
